Java Developer (Closed)
SkillStorm is seeking a Java Developer for our client in Jersey City, NJ. Candidates must be able to work on SkillStorm's W2; not a C2C position. EOE, including disability/vets.
Job Description:
- BS in Computer Science, CIS, Math, or similar (MS is preferred).
- Excellent communication and collaboration skills.
- Experience working as a Java software developer for at least 3 years, including Spring, Spring MVC, Spring Boot, Spring Batch.
- Experience designing and implementing RESTful web services in Java.
- Experience with Oracle RDBMS and PL/SQL.
- Experience using test-driven development with JUnit and mocking.
- Understanding of release planning, testing cycles.
- Familiarity with software version control (we use git), issue management (we use JIRA).
Required Skills:
- BS in Computer Science, CIS, Math, or similar (MS is preferred).
- Excellent communication and collaboration skills.
- Experience working as a Java software developer for at least 3 years, including Spring, Spring MVC, Spring Boot, Spring Batch.
- Experience designing and implementing RESTful web services in Java.
- Experience with Oracle RDBMS and PL/SQL.
- Experience using test-driven development with JUnit and mocking.
- Understanding of release planning, testing cycles.
- Familiarity with software version control (we use git), issue management (we use JIRA).
Desired Skills:
- Experience working in an agile project.
- Experience doing behavior-driven development (we use Concordion).
- Experience automating build and deployment tasks.
- Experience with Angular, Typescript, Node.js.
- Experience with AutoSys, shell scripting, Linux.
- Experience working for a financial company.
#LI-DNI
Similar Jobs
Entry Level Software Developer
Contract job in Orlando
Entry Level Software Developer
Contract job in Melbourne
Application Architect V
Contract job in Jersey City
Technical Project Manager
Contract job in Jersey City